Posted by: Adam in Lateral Thinking Puzzles, PodcastsThis week’s puzzle is called The Man in the Painting:
A man stands in front of a painting and says the following: “Brothers and sisters have I none, but this man’s father is my father’s son.” How is the man in the painting related to the man who is in front of it?
This puzzle comes from Lateral Thinking Puzzlers by Paul Sloane.
